scsi: ufs: core: Fix the polling implementation

Fix the following issues in ufshcd_poll():

 - If polling succeeds, return a positive value.

 - Do not complete polling requests from interrupt context because the
   block layer expects these requests to be completed from thread
   context. From block/bio.c:

     If REQ_ALLOC_CACHE is set, the final put of the bio MUST be done from
     process context, not hard/soft IRQ.

Fixes: eaab9b5730 ("scsi: ufs: Implement polling support")
